"Satellite Communication" by D.C. Agarwal is a detailed textbook that covers the fundamental concepts of satellite communication, including the basics of satellite systems, orbital mechanics, communication systems, and antennas. In conclusion, "Satellite Communication" by D.C. Agarwal provides a comprehensive overview of the principles, technologies, and applications of satellite communication. The book is an essential resource for students, researchers, and professionals in the field of telecommunications, satellite communication, and related areas.
